Definitions

  • the invention relates to a method and a device for controlling the light range of a vehicle headlight.
  • the low beam is not always optimally adjusted
  • the high beam is switched on very differently, regardless of oncoming traffic and street lighting;
  • the drivers turn on the headlights subjectively according to their own feelings, without taking into account the actual lighting of the streets.
  • the invention is therefore based on the object of providing a method and a device for controlling the headlight range of a vehicle, which contributes to an increase in safety in road traffic and enables an automatic, needs-based and correct headlamp adjustment in driving operation.
  • the headlight range is increased at high speed values and reduced at low speed values, and the control of the headlight range of the vehicle headlight is also dependent on at least one further environmental parameter (distance and / or backlight of a third-party vehicle and / ambient light).
  • the headlight range is increased at higher speeds according to the invention, thereby increasing the field of view.
  • the control circuit according to the invention receives signals from the speed detector about the actual speed of the vehicle, and a higher headlight range is set in accordance with the speed actually driven.
  • the light range in this speed range is from at least 15% to 25% of the permissible maximum value up to the approximate maximum value of the light range.
  • the control of the headlight range takes place in a speed range that is typically driven within closed towns, i.e.
  • the maximum beam range of the low beam is set, since better illumination of the road is required at higher speeds. If a third-party vehicle comes with light, this is detected by the sensor device and the headlight range is immediately delayed by a certain amount of approximately 25% of the maximum value. borrowed reduced to avoid glare for other road users due to the maximum beam range of the low beam.
  • the lighting range is adjusted as a function of at least one further environmental parameter, in particular with regard to a third-party vehicle, in order to increase safety in traffic, in particular to prevent dazzling oncoming traffic or someone driving ahead in the same direction.
  • the control of the headlight range of the vehicle headlight takes place as a function of the further environmental parameter such that the distance of a third-party vehicle traveling in the same direction is detected by means of a distance sensor, and the headlight range is automatically reduced after falling below a predetermined minimum distance value becomes.
  • the control of the luminous range of the vehicle takes place as a function of the further environmental parameter of a third-party vehicle in such a way that the backlight of the oncoming third-party vehicle is detected by means of a backlight sensor, and the lighting range after a Backlight signal is automatically reduced.
  • the reduction in the headlight range can also include an immediate switching off of the high beam or switching to low beam.
  • the backlight is detected by the backlight sensor in the driver's line of sight.
  • the control of the headlight range is expediently carried out continuously as a function of the vehicle's own speed within a certain tolerance band, the entire adjustment of the headlight range being carried out within the tolerance band using the tolerance band.
  • the lighting range is continuously changed in a linear dependence on the measured speed.
  • Figure 1 is a schematic diagram of a headlight range control according to the invention.
  • Figure 2 is a schematic view of a vehicle with differently adjusted lighting ranges.
  • the exemplary embodiment of the invention shown in FIG. 1 comprises a device for controlling the headlight range of a vehicle headlight 3 which is pivotably mounted about a pivot axis 1 and which can be adjusted by means of an electrically controllable adjusting element 2, with a control circuit 4 which acts on the lamp adjustment and which is dependent on the speed detector 5 (Vehicle tachometer) measured, actual vehicle speed, the headlight range 3 is increased at high speed values and reduced at low speed values, and with a sensor device coupled to the control circuit 4, by means of which additional environmental parameters (distance and / or backlight of a third vehicle and / or ambient light ) are recorded.
  • additional environmental parameters distance and / or backlight of a third vehicle and / or ambient light
  • the sensor device has a distance sensor 7, which is electrically coupled to the control circuit 4, for detecting the distance of a third-party vehicle traveling in the same direction (not shown in the figures), the control circuit 4 regulating the headlight range of the vehicle headlight 3 as a function of the measured distance such that the headlight range after falling below a predetermined minimum distance value depends on the actual vehicle speed can depend, is automatically reduced.
  • the sensor device also has a back-light sensor 8, which is electrically coupled to the control circuit 4 and has a photo diode 9 or the like, and has an imaging lens 10 for detecting the back-light 11 of an oncoming third-party vehicle (not shown in the figures), the control circuit 4 controlling the Controls the light range of the vehicle headlight 3 as a function of the backlight 11 of a third-party vehicle such that the headlight range is automatically reduced after a backlight signal has been detected.
  • a back-light sensor 8 which is electrically coupled to the control circuit 4 and has a photo diode 9 or the like, and has an imaging lens 10 for detecting the back-light 11 of an oncoming third-party vehicle (not shown in the figures), the control circuit 4 controlling the Controls the light range of the vehicle headlight 3 as a function of the backlight 11 of a third-party vehicle such that the headlight range is automatically reduced after a backlight signal has been detected.
  • the sensor device furthermore has an ambient light sensor 12 electrically coupled to the control circuit 4, with a further photodiode 13 or the like light-sensitive component and with a further imaging lens 14, the control circuit 4 regulating the light range of the vehicle headlight 3 in dependence on the ambient light 15 such that the Headlight range is controlled when the ambient light 15 falls below a predetermined threshold value in the sense of an automatic switching on or off of the vehicle light.
  • the sensor device has an inclination sensor 6 which is electrically coupled to the control circuit 4, which is coupled to a plurality of level sensors provided in the vehicle, and which supplies the control circuit 4 with a signal value corresponding to the load condition of the vehicle in such a way that the control of the light range of the vehicle headlight 3 is dependent the vehicle inclination is corrected automatically.
  • the control circuit 4 is supplied with electrical energy from the alternator or vehicle battery via a relay 16.
  • the filaments for low beam and high beam of the bulb 20 of the headlight are supplied with electrical current via further relays 17 and 18.
  • the control circuit 4 is electrically coupled to the relays 17, 18.
  • a program for controlling all functions of the headlight range control is stored in the control circuit 4.
  • the ambient lighting is first measured by means of the light sensor 12. If the ambient lighting is less than a predetermined limit value of, for example, 300 lx, the low beam 22c of the headlight 3 is switched on automatically, the light range initially being set to a minimum value Lc, taking into account the charge state of the vehicle measured by the inclination sensor 6 19. Likewise, when driving into underground garages, underpasses, tunnels, etc., the low beam of the headlamp is switched on automatically by means of the light sensor 12 and the control circuit 4.
  • the swivel angle ⁇ and thus the lighting range of the vehicle headlights 3 are set continuously as a function of the actually measured speed value of the vehicle 19 within an angular range with predetermined lower and upper limit values corresponding to the minimum and maximum lighting ranges Lc and La. For example, at a measured vehicle speed of 60 km / h and above this, according to the state “a” according to FIG. 2, a maximum beam range La of the low beam 22a of the headlights 3 is set, as a result of which the road is illuminated to a maximum.
  • the beam range of the low beam 22b of the headlight 3 is conveyed the control circuit 4 is continuously reduced to an intermediate value Lb, for example the headlight range is set at an actual speed of 40 km / h according to the state “b” according to FIG. 2 to the value Lb corresponding to a value reduced by 35% of the maximum value La.
  • the lower limit value Lc of the light range of, for example, about 15% to 25% of the maximum value of the light range is set in accordance with state “c” according to FIG
  • the headlights 3 of the vehicle 19 are steplessly controlled between the two predetermined limit values of the headlight range as a function of the vehicle's own speed.
  • a correction of the headlight range control can be proportional to the load of the vehicle 19 and accordingly the signals of the inclination sensor 6 are made.
  • the high beam 23 can be switched on automatically in accordance with the state “f” according to FIG. 2 if, cumulatively, all of the following conditions are met:
  • the backlight sensor 8 does not register any backlight
  • the distance sensor 7 does not register a third vehicle driving in front of the vehicle 19 within a predetermined distance range
  • the vehicle's own speed is at least 60 km / h
  • - The ambient light sensor 12 has registered an "absolute" darkness of the surroundings.
  • the high beam 23 is automatically switched off as soon as an oncoming vehicle is detected by the backlight sensor 8 or the vehicle 19 approaches a third vehicle in front so far that the specified minimum distance value is undershot.
  • a reduction in the beam range of the low beam is carried out, depending on the vehicle's own speed. For example, at the vehicle's own speeds of more than 60 km / h, headlight range reductions of at least 25% of the total maximum permitted headlight range value La are carried out as soon as an oncoming or approaching third-party vehicle is registered.
  • the low beam is advantageously switched on automatically when the engine is running as soon as the ambient light sensor 12 detects a signal level of the ambient light which is below a predetermined twilight threshold value.
  • control circuit 4 can also be assigned a receiving and transmitting unit 21, which has a further distance detector and detects the distance from following third-party vehicles traveling in the same direction and, if the value falls below a predetermined minimum distance value, immediately shuts off any switch on High beam of the third vehicle controls.
  • the third vehicle also has a corresponding transmitting and receiving unit 21, the receiving part of which responds to the signal emitted by the transmitting part of the vehicle's own transmitting and receiving device 21 and independently controls a control of the high beam or headlight range of the headlight of the third vehicle. In this way, glare to the driver due to vehicles following on the rear can be prevented, which further improves safety in traffic.

Abstract

L'invention concerne un procédé et un dispositif servant à la commande de la portée lumineuse d'un phare de véhicule (3). Dans le procédé et le dispositif selon l'invention, la portée lumineuse est accrue, en fonction de la vitesse propre du véhicule, pour des vitesses élevées et est diminuée pour des vitesses faibles. Ce faisant, la commande de la portée lumineuse du phare (3) prend également en compte au moins un paramètre ambiant supplémentaire distance ou lumière opposée (11) d'un véhicule tiers ou lumière ambiante (15). A cet effet, on détecte la distance d'un véhicule tiers roulant dans le même sens au moyen d'un capteur de distance (7), la portée lumineuse étant automatiquement diminuée en cas de dépassement bas d'une valeur de distance minimale prédéfinie; on détecte également la lumière opposée (11) provenant d'un véhicule tiers venant en sens inverse au moyen d'un capteur de lumière opposée (8), la portée lumineuse étant automatiquement diminuée après détection d'un signal correspondant.
